International credit rating agency Moody’s has changed its outlook on the Government of Papua New Guinea’s B2 rating from ‘stable’ to ‘negative’. What’s behind the move and what does it mean?

The anticipated signing of a gas agreement for Pasca A, Papua New Guinea’s first undersea gas project, has stalled at the eleventh hour. Developer Twinza Oil says it will stand down its project team due to a last-minute State request it claims would render the project ‘unfinanceable’.

The Porgera gold mine in Enga Prince looks set to reopen later this year after the Papua New Guinea Government and mine operator Barrick Gold reached a ‘binding framework agreement’ to share future benefits from the mine and boost local ownership.
